Be sure to unplug the power supply and turn o the water source before cleaning. Do not plug the
power supply with wet hands, or there will be a risk of electric shock.
Wipe the suace of the slushy machine shell by using a soft towel or sponge dipped in warm water
(a diluted neutral detergent is available).
After washing with detergent, wipe it o promptly with a soft cloth or sponge dipped in water.
Wipe the water o the suace of the enclosure with a d cloth.
Please never spill water directly on the machine. Failure to do so may result in a power leakage or
accident.
Check once or twice a month to conrm whether the power cord is damaged.

Even if there are scars on the sealing ring that cannot be seen with the naked eye, it may cause prob-
lems such as "slush leakage", so please replace the new product regularly with a rough replacement
period of three months. Even within the replacement period, if there is a problem such as scars, please
replace it in time.

After working for a period of time, the condenser
will be dusty and aect the heat dissipation, and
the cooling eect will become worse
(Manifested as: the output of the slush decreases
or the slush is dicult to be formed), please clean
once eve three months (if the using environment
is poor, please clean once a month), be sure to ask a
professional cleaner to clean, turn o the power
before cleaning, and pay attention not to damage
condenser ns of the vessel.
Cleaning of The Condenser
Do not touch the condenser ns directly with your hands as this can cause inju.
When disassembling the right panel, pay attention to the display protection.
